Why Live in Briarcrest

Briarcrest Estates, located on the southern side of Bryan, TX, is a neighborhood with a rich history dating back to the 1970s. Situated about 4 miles from downtown Bryan, this area is known for its unique architectural designs from the late 70s and early 80s, with many homes featuring modern interior renovations. The neighborhood is centered around the City Course at the Phillips Event Center, a public 18-hole golf course that offers a challenging parkland-style layout. Residents can enjoy crafted cocktails and diverse menu options at 1929, the on-site restaurant. Camelot Park provides a serene spot for outdoor activities, including a walking path, playground, and a little free library. The Bryan Aquatic Center, with its Olympic-sized pool, is a popular destination during the hot summer months. Briarcrest Drive is a hub of activity, lined with shopping centers, restaurants, and local shops, including Walmart and Bryan Towne Center, which features retailers like Target. Dining options include Station on 29th for barbecue and JJ’s Snowcones for a refreshing treat. The neighborhood's convenient location along Briarcrest Drive and Texas Avenue ensures easy access to most of Bryan/College Station, with Texas A&M University and downtown Bryan both just 4 miles away. St. Joseph Health Regional Hospital is 2 miles from the neighborhood, and Easterwood Airport, offering flights to Dallas-Fort Worth, is 6 miles away. Briarcrest Estates is a low crime risk area, making it a safer choice compared to the national average.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is Briarcrest a good place to live?
Briarcrest is a good place to live. Briarcrest is considered very car-dependent and bikeable. Briarcrest has 1 park for recreational activities. It is fairly sparse in population with 3.1 people per acre and a median age of 41. The average household income is $98,617 which is above the national average. College graduates make up 40.2% of residents. A majority of residents in Briarcrest are home owners, with 29.4% of residents renting and 70.6% of residents owning their home. How much do you need to make to afford a house in Briarcrest?
The median home price in Briarcrest is $363,400. If you put a 20% down payment of $72,700 and had a 30-year fixed mortgage with an interest rate of 6.56%, your estimated principal and interest payment would be $1,850 a month plus property taxes, HOA fees, home insurance, PMI, and utilities. Using the 28% rule, you would need to make at least $79K a year to afford the median home price in Briarcrest. The average household income in Briarcrest is $99K.
